A classic New Mexico burger topped with roasted green chile and melted cheese. Albuquerque is especially known for this smoky, spicy local favorite.
A flour tortilla filled with eggs, potatoes, cheese, and often bacon or chorizo, then smothered or served with red or green chile. A staple local breakfast.
Pork marinated in red chile and slow-cooked until tender. It is one of the signature dishes of traditional New Mexican cuisine in Albuquerque.

Generally cheaper than many large U.S. cities. Hotels and casual dining are reasonable, while tourist areas and upscale restaurants cost more.
Tip 15-20% in restaurants; 20%+ for great service. Tip bartenders USD 1-2 per drink, hotel staff USD 2-5, and round up or tip 10-15% for taxis and rideshares.
